Terdapat enam jenis operator Java iaitu: 1. Operator aritmetik, "+", "-", "*", "/", "%", "++", "--" "; 2. Pengendali tugasan, "=", "+=", "-=", "*=", "/=", "+"; 3. Operator perbandingan, ">", "=", "
Persekitaran pengendalian tutorial ini: 1. Sistem Windows 10, versi Java 20, komputer DELL G3.
Operator Java dibahagikan kepada enam kategori utama: operator aritmetik, operator tugasan, operator perbandingan, operator logik, operator bersyarat (ternari), operator bitwise
1. Operator Aritmetik: + (tambahan) , - (tolak), * (darab), / (bahagi), % (baki), ++ (naik kendiri), -- (turun sendiri)
2. Operator tugasan: = (sama ), += (kenaikan sekali adalah sama), -= (penurunan sekali adalah sama), *= (darab sendiri sekali adalah sama), /= (bahagi sekali adalah sama), + (penggabungan rentetan) (simbol)
3. Pengendali perbandingan: > (lebih besar daripada), = (lebih besar daripada atau sama dengan),
Hasil pulangan hanya: benar atau salah
4. Operator logik: & (bitwise AND), && (litar pintas DAN), | (bitwise ATAU), ||. (litar pintas atau),! (bukan, iaitu penolakan)
5. Pengendali bersyarat (ternary, ternary): ?:
6. Bitwise operator (semua Dikira berdasarkan binari): & (bitwise AND), | (bitwise OR), ^ (operasi OR eksklusif), >(pengendali tidak ditandatangani), ~(bukan, pengendali penolakan)
Pengendali bitwise memerlukan pengetahuan
Nota: Integer lalai kepada jenis int
1. + (tambahan), - (tolak), * (darab), / (bahagi), % (baki), ++ (naik kendiri), -- (turun sendiri)
1.+
2. 3.*
4./
Nota: Bit integer lalai ialah jenis int, tepat kepada titik perpuluhan, nilai mesti dibuang
5.%
6.++
dibahagikan kepada dua jenis: ++i (pertama tambah sendiri dan kemudian keluaran) dan i++ (pertama keluaran dan kemudian tambah sendiri, biasanya digunakan), Penjelasan umum ialah sesiapa yang berada di hadapan akan didahulukan.
Atas ialah kandungan terperinci Apakah klasifikasi pengendali java?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!